Назад | Перейти на главную страницу

Awstats: объединение журналов HTTP и HTTPS

Plesk хранит файлы конфигурации для AWStats в следующей папке:

/usr/local/psa/etc/awstats

В конце файлов конфигурации для домена для HTTP + S находится следующая строка для пользовательских изменений, поскольку файлы перезаписываются Plesk:

/etc/awstats/awstats.conf.local

Теперь у меня вопрос, как я могу объединить оба журнала для HTTP и HTTPS в анализе журналов для AWStats, чтобы получить комбинацию обоих? Это означает, что посетители домена для HTTP и HTTPS должны быть объединены в один сводный файл AWStats (без перезаписи Plesk).

Примечание. Мне известно следующее: Что Server Fault должен делать с вопросами о панелях управления веб-хостингом? но этот вопрос, как правило, касается AWStats, Plesk просто играет роль перезаписи некоторых файлов конфигурации, ничего глубоко не связанного с самим вопросом imho.

Следующий https://www.howtoforge.com/logresolvemerge.pl_merge_apache_access_logs

В Awstats есть инструмент logresolvemerge.pl который позволяет вам объединять разные файлы в один, что очень полезно для вашей ситуации или когда у вас есть несколько веб-серверов с балансировкой нагрузки.

Вы должны использовать это как

logresolvemerge.pl ${file1} ${..} ${filen} > ${resultfile}

Надеюсь, поможет.

Измените настройки ведения журнала, чтобы запросы https и http регистрировались в одном файле.